As a System Debug Engineer at AMD, you will be an integral part of the Server DPPM Execution and Debug team. In this position, your responsibilities will include conducting platform and DPPM debugging for AMD server processors. Collaborating closely with Hardware System Engineering teams and other stakeholders, you will play a key role in driving enhancements to the debugging process.

The Person:

The AMD Server Platform Validation Team is seeking a proactive DPPM Debug Engineer to join our expanding team, concentrating on the EPYC server processors. The ideal candidate should possess a solid grasp of the overall silicon manufacturing engineering process, along with exceptional verbal and written communication skills. 

Key Responsibilities:

  • Responsible for performing second-level debugging for product issues and addressing testing  obstacles in a data center environment.
  • Oversee and monitor technical issues, risks, and priorities while managing team communications, including updates on program status, potential risks, and opportunities.
  • Enhance debugging capabilities and methodologies by identifying recurring challenges or barriers to efficient debugging and collaborating with partner organizations to promote innovation in platform architecture, design, tools, and techniques. 

 

Preferred Experience:

  • 3+ years of expertise in product and test engineering, with a focus on silicon debug and failure analysis/fault isolation.
  • Solid background in semiconductor debug, fault isolation, failure analysis, and product engineering yield debug.
  • Proficient understanding of PC platform hardware, Operating Systems, Device Drivers, and System BIOS interactions.
  • Knowledgeable in Linux and scripting languages, such as Python, Perl, or Ruby.
  • Good communication and coordination abilities.

 

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Proficient in probability and statistics, with experience in Design of Experiments (DOE).
  • Well-versed in Design for Debug (DFD) and Design for Test (DFT) technologies. 

 

Academic credentials:

  • BS or MS degree in Electrical Engineering or related major with 3+ years of applicable experience.
